For individuals searching for "RV parks near me" in the Jonesboro, Georgia area, it's important to be aware of all types of housing options that might appear in such searches, including mobile home parks. Tara, located at 7735 Tara Blvd, Jonesboro, GA 30236, USA, is one such facility. The limited customer feedback available online offers a contrasting perspective, with one comment expressing a positive experience related to community building, while another raises serious concerns about pest infestations and waste management.
One brief review offers an optimistic outlook, stating, "Hello 👋 Everyone and yes it's been a great experience working and building Our Community one day at a time. Thanks you." This comment suggests that there are ongoing efforts to foster a positive community environment within Tara Mobile Home Park. It implies a sense of progress and collaboration among residents and potentially management to create a better living space. For individuals who value a strong sense of community and are looking for a place where they can actively participate in its development, this comment might be encouraging. It hints at a potential for positive social interaction and a shared goal of improvement within the park.
However, a starkly contrasting review paints a concerning picture of the living conditions at Tara Mobile Home Park. This reviewer lists a significant number of pest issues, stating, "Cockroaches & Roaches. Rats & Possums. stray Cats & Dogs. Bad Mosquitos, Flies & gnats." This detailed list suggests a potentially severe and widespread problem with various types of pests within the community. Such infestations can lead to unsanitary living conditions, health hazards, and a general decrease in the quality of life for residents. The presence of stray animals can also pose challenges related to noise, safety, and hygiene.
Adding to these concerns, the same reviewer mentions a significant issue with waste management, stating that "Trash haven’t been picked up in 2 weeks to make things worse." Prolonged delays in trash collection can exacerbate pest problems, create unpleasant odors, and further contribute to an unhygienic environment. Effective waste management is a fundamental aspect of maintaining a livable community, and a two-week lapse in service is a serious concern.
